In October 1859, Charles Dickens gave a reading of his festive classic “A Christmas Carol” at St Andrew’s Hall, to great acclaim.
Following his sell-out reading at The Halls of excerpts from “Nicholas Nickleby”, local actor, writer and director David Lambert presents a reading of the timeless novella that almost single-handedly created our view of the Festive Season and all that makes it special.
Come and hear the story of the skin-flint Ebenezer Scrooge’s visitation by the Spirits of Christmas Past, Present and Future, and his journey from miser to merry-maker – with table seating, so you can relax with a drink from the bar, this is the perfect start to the Yuletide festivities.
